Flex3环境配置以及Flex3和java整合开发步骤
Flex3是Adobe公司推出的一种基于ActionScript 3的富互联网应用程序(RIA)开发框架,它提供了强大的组件库和丰富的交互设计能力。与Java的整合开发则可以利用后端服务器的强大处理能力,实现数据的动态交互。本文将详细介绍Flex3的环境配置以及Flex3和Java的整合开发步骤。一、Flex3环境配置1.安装Adobe Flash Player:Flex应用运行在Flash Player环境中,所以首先需要在目标计算机上安装最新版本的Flash Player。 2.下载并安装Flex SDK:Flex SDK包含了编译和创建Flex应用程序所需的工具和库。可以从Adobe官方网站下载并解压到指定目录。 3.配置环境变量:将Flex SDK的bin目录添加到系统PATH环境变量中,这样可以在命令行中直接调用Flex编译工具。 4.安装集成开发环境(IDE):推荐使用MyEclipse 6.5,它是一款强大的Java EE集成开发环境,支持Flex插件。安装MyEclipse后,需要通过插件管理器安装Flex Builder插件。 5.配置MyEclipse:在MyEclipse中配置Flex Builder,指定Flex SDK路径,并设置相关构建路径。二、Flex3项目实例开发1.创建Flex项目:在MyEclipse中选择“新建”->“Flex项目”,输入项目名,选择Flex SDK版本,然后完成项目创建。 2.设计用户界面:使用Flex Builder的图形化界面设计工具(MXML)创建组件布局,包括各种UI控件如按钮、文本框等。 3.编写ActionScript代码:在MXML文件中或者单独的AS文件中编写业务逻辑代码,实现组件的交互功能。 4.运行和调试:在MyEclipse中可以直接运行Flex项目,查看效果;也可以设置断点进行调试。三、Flex3与Java整合开发1.创建Java后端服务:使用Java开发Web服务,例如使用Spring MVC或Struts2框架创建RESTful API。 2.配置Flex与Java通信:Flex应用可以通过HTTPService或WebService组件与Java后端进行数据交换。需要在Flex项目中配置相应的服务引用。 3.发送和接收数据:在Flex中调用Java服务的方法,发送请求并接收响应数据,通常使用AMF(Action Message Format)进行高效的数据传输。 4.数据处理:在Flex客户端解析接收到的数据,更新UI,同时在Java端处理来自Flex的请求,处理业务逻辑并返回结果。 5.安全性考虑:为保证数据安全,可能需要进行身份验证和授权,可以使用Flex Security框架和Java的安全机制进行配合。通过以上步骤,你可以成功配置Flex3开发环境,并且掌握Flex3与Java的整合开发基础。对于初学者来说,实践中不断探索和学习,将有助于深入理解和掌握这一技术。在提供的练习代码中,你可以进一步了解实际开发中的细节和技巧,提高自己的技能水平。
1.16MB
文件大小:
评论区